About the Intel Core i5-5250U CPU

The Intel Core i5-5250U is an end-of-life 2-core (4-thread) processor built for the mobile CPU market. It launched in Q1 2015 with a suggested retail price of $315. It is part of Intel's Core i5 lineup, which is based on the Broadwell-U microarchitecture. The i5-5250U is compatible with Intel BGA 1168 motherboards and is fabricated on Intel's 14 nm manufacturing process. It features the Intel HD 6000 integrated graphics solution.

Memory and Cache

The Core i5-5250U supports DDR3 memory and features a dual-channel memory controller, allowing it to utilize 2 memory modules simultaneously. In terms of cache, the Core i5-5250U has multiple levels of cache. Its L1 cache, which is the smallest and fastest, is 64 KB in size, providing rapid access to crucial instructions. Its L2 cache, at 256 KB, is larger but slower than the L1. Its L3 cache, a shared resource among the CPU's cores, has a capacity of 3 MB.

Cores and Clock Speeds

The Core i5-5250U features 2 total cores which can process 4 threads simultaneously. The multi-threading capability allows the CPU to execute multiple computational tasks in parallel. The base clock speed of the CPU is 1600.0 MHz, and it can boost up to 2.7 GHz under heavy workloads. Higher clock speeds result in better performance for the same microarchitecture. The multiplier is locked, making it incapable of overclocking for pushing performance further.

About the Intel Core i3-N300 CPU

The Intel Core i3-N300 is a 8-core (8-thread) processor built for the mobile CPU market. It launched in Q1 2023 with a suggested retail price of $309. It is part of Intel's Core i3 lineup, which is based on the Alder Lake-N microarchitecture. The i3-N300 is compatible with Intel BGA 1264 motherboards and is fabricated on Intel's 10 nm manufacturing process. It features the UHD Graphics 770 integrated graphics solution.

Memory and Cache

The Core i3-N300 supports DDR4-3200, DDR5 memory and features a single-channel memory controller, allowing it to utilize 1 memory modules simultaneously. In terms of cache, the Core i3-N300 has multiple levels of cache. Its L1 cache, which is the smallest and fastest, is 96 KB in size, providing rapid access to crucial instructions. Its L2 cache, at 2 MB, is larger but slower than the L1. Its L3 cache, a shared resource among the CPU's cores, has a capacity of 6 MB.

Cores and Clock Speeds

The Core i3-N300 features 8 total cores which can process 8 threads simultaneously. The multi-threading capability allows the CPU to execute multiple computational tasks in parallel. The base clock speed of the CPU is 100.0 MHz, and it can boost up to 3.7 GHz under heavy workloads. Higher clock speeds result in better performance for the same microarchitecture. The multiplier is locked, making it incapable of overclocking for pushing performance further.
